'It was an extension of how Argentina had acted for the past six weeks, committing the most fouls of any team and backing themselves to see off every challenge through sheer belligerence.
'How fitting that such a crude approach should finally be crushed by Spain, the consummate technicians, and that Fernández should play the fall guy.
'After all, this was not the first time the midfielder had behaved reprehensibly. It was not even the first time this week. Against England he had announced himself in the semi-final by whacking Elliot Anderson on the back of the head, before celebrating his goal with a gesture to suggest that his critics had too much to say. Topo Gigio, it is called in Argentina, where a player cups his hands behind his ears and invites his adversaries to keep talking.'

🚨 BREAKING: Early reports indicate that the AFA is considering BIG legal action over the misinformation campaign targeting Argentina’s players during the World Cup.
The potential defamation lawsuits would reportedly focus on false allegations, manipulated or unverified images, and accusations made without evidence.
The AFA is expected to go “all in,” targeting not only major media outlets and prominent accounts on social medias like X, Instagram and Tiktok, but ANYONE (even with few followers) who contributed to spreading the campaign, regardless of the size of their audience.
A legal team is reportedly already collecting evidence, including posts, screenshots and other material. Further developments are expected.
